Account impersonation via case-sensitive email uniqueness
Published Apr 16, 2024 · Updated Aug 1, 2024
Authentication flaw in Lunary before 1.0.2 allows remote attackers to create duplicate identities by changing an email address's letter case. The signup path compares email strings case-sensitively instead of normalizing them before enforcing uniqueness, so differently cased forms of one address receive separate accounts. No authentication or user interaction is required, and the resulting identity collision enables account impersonation and user confusion without interrupting service.
